Peel police are investigating an early-morning fire at a home in Brampton.

Emergency crews were called to the home on Saddlecreek Court near Highway 407 and McLaughlin Road South around 4:40 a.m. on Wednesday.

Police say the house was evacuated along with neighbouring homes.

No injuries have been reported.

Police initially told 680 NewsRadio they were investigating the fire as an arson. However, in a later update, said the fire is not currently being treated as arson and the cause is still under investigation.
